Accelerators for early-stage startups are intensive programs designed to support nascent companies through mentorship, funding, networking, and resources. They typically run over a fixed period, aiming to fast-track startup growth, validate business models, and prepare entrepreneurs for future funding rounds or market entry.
Key Features
- Structured mentorship and guidance from industry experts
- Seed funding or investment opportunities
- Cohort-based program with peer networking
- Focused curriculum on product development, business model, and scaling
- Demo days or pitching sessions to attract investors
- Access to co-working spaces and resources
Pros
- Provides valuable mentorship and expertise
- Access to initial funding and investor networks
- Accelerates product development and go-to-market strategies
- Builds a supportive community of startups
- Enhances credibility and visibility in the market
Cons
- Intense time commitment can be demanding for founders
- May require giving up equity or ownership stake
- Not all programs fit every startup's needs or industry
- High competition to get accepted into top accelerators
- Potential dependency on program resources rather than sustainable growth
